您可以通过在GroupBox的标题上放置标签来绕过问题,但我不一定会建议这样做。

一旦了解了正在发生的事情及其发生的原因,就会出现更好的解决方案。问题是控件的字体(以及其他内容)是环境属性,这意味着子控件继承其父/容器控件的属性。因此,如果将GroupBox设置为使用粗体字体,则默认情况下,其所有子控件都会自动继承bold属性。

当然,关键是默认情况下。仅当您未将子项的属性显式设置为其他项时,环境属性才适用。如果您不希望子控件为粗体,请全部选中它们并关闭粗体。父/容器的设置将不再覆盖新的自定义设置。

为了使事情变得更容易,您可以将Panel控件添加到GroupBox,停靠/锚定它以填充GroupBox控件的整个客户区域,并将其设置为使用标准的非粗体字体。然后,环境控制规则规定您添加到Panel的子控件默认不会是粗体。这样,您只需更改一个控件的font属性,而不是添加到GroupBox的每个子控件。

这比尝试在GroupBox标题上添加Label控件更好的原因是因为GroupBox被设计为包含控件。您可以利用对接和锚定属性来确保所有内容都正确排列,并且您不必在这样做时与设计师对抗,以确保自定义Label正确覆盖GroupBox控件绘制的默认标签。另外,你不会遇到Z顺序问题,或者在运行时将其他重绘问题放在丑陋的头上,例如,Label控件被意外地隐藏在GroupBox后面,没有人能看到它(以及其他一些潜在的混乱) )。

html如何使文本变为粗体_如何使组框的文本变为粗体而不是其中包含的控件的文本?...相关推荐

  1. 背水一战 Windows 10 (30) - 控件(文本类): AutoSuggestBox

    背水一战 Windows 10 (30) - 控件(文本类): AutoSuggestBox 原文:背水一战 Windows 10 (30) - 控件(文本类): AutoSuggestBox [源码 ...

  2. 易语言编程: 让读屏软件可获取标签控件的文本

    易语言编程: 让读屏软件可获取标签控件的文本 将易语言的非标准标签控件修改为标准的标签控件,使屏幕阅读器可获取到标签的内容 在使用易语言创建窗口控件时,我们会发现:易语言的编辑框.组合框.列表框等控件 ...

  3. C# winform 让ComboBox控件的文本居中方法

    在C#中,当将ComboBox的属性DropDownStyle设置为DropDownList后,ComboBox2框的文本默认是靠左对齐的. 用ComboBox1举例,让下拉文本居中,订阅事件: pu ...

  4. MFC中通过SendMessage修改Edit控件的文本

    通过Windows API可以方便地实现. 3步走: HWND hWnd = ::FindWindow(NULL,"showPicture"); HWND hEdit = ::Ge ...

  5. 0pyqt获取textEdit控件的文本

    仅作为记录,大佬请跳过. 获取获取textEdit控件的文本的命令是 toPlainText() TEXT=self.textEdit.toPlainText() 而linEdit才直接用text() ...

  6. 遍历结构体_三菱ST语言编程(3)——结构体变量

    上篇文章介绍了数组,是一组相同类型数据的列表,那么不同类型的数据能否组合到一起用一个标签表示呢?答案当然是可以的,而实现这个功能的就是结构体(struct). 建立结构体 在三菱结构化编程的界面中左侧 ...

  7. wxpython富文本_Python实例讲解 -- wxpython 基本的控件 (文本)

    使用基本的控件工作 wxPython 工具包提供了多种不同的窗口部件,包括了本章所提到的基本控件.我们涉及静态文本.可编辑的文本.按钮.微调.滑块.复选框.单选按钮.选择器.列表框.组合框和标尺.对于 ...

  8. Python实例讲解 -- wxpython 基本的控件 (文本)

    使用基本的控件工作 wxPython 工具包提供了多种不同的窗口部件,包括了本章所提到的基本控件.我们涉及静态文本.可编辑的文本.按钮.微调.滑块.复选框.单选按钮.选择器.列表框.组合框和标尺.对于 ...

  9. wxpython 基本的控件 (文本)

    wxPython 工具包提供了多种不同的窗口部件,包括了本章所提到的基本控件.我们涉及静态文本.可编辑的文本.按钮.微调.滑块.复选框.单选按钮.选择器.列表框.组合框和标尺.对于每种窗口部件,我们将 ...

最新文章

  1. C语言下标要求数组或指针,c语言改错 error C2109: 下标要求数组或指针类型怎么改?...
  2. 使用DBUnit框架数据库插入特殊字符失败的查错经历
  3. leetcode 263. 丑数(Java版)
  4. 微软把UWP定位成业务线应用程序开发平台
  5. cake fork什么意思_Java7任务并行执行神器:Forkamp;Join框架
  6. Linux 命令之 dmidecode -- 显示机器的DMI信息
  7. Mongodb 分片与副本集
  8. margin 塌陷bug 触发bfc
  9. 2021全球智能手机出货13.2亿部,第一依旧是他,小米苹果紧随其后
  10. Linux vi的复制和粘贴快捷键
  11. MongoDB Documents
  12. SEO优化之——html页面相关总结
  13. java读取mysql配置文件_MySql主从复制,从原理到实践
  14. python100题语感练习_Python 100题练习8
  15. 在退出作用域时做一些事
  16. python 方差齐性检验_SPSS方差齐性检验(图文+视频教程)
  17. Spring Boot 定制个性 banner
  18. linux va list,vsprintf函数以及va_list使用详解
  19. 巧妙地数组之类的数据平移
  20. python打开图片出错 IOError: cannot identify image file 解决方法

热门文章

  1. 什么是压力测试,在哪里做压力测试,软件压力测试存在哪些问题?
  2. 五款轻量型bug管理工具横向测评
  3. linux内核版本查询
  4. 美国纽约大学超级计算机中心,纽约大学超级计算集群系统案例
  5. 俄罗斯最大社交网站(vk.com)被黑一亿数据 附图
  6. 晋升答辩,leader嫡系拿着我和另一个同事的项目去答辩,关键我们三个人是同一组答辩,这也太恶心了吧?...
  7. ESXi-6.7 支持Realtek81XX 8125网卡镜像
  8. PTCMS仿蜻蜓听书在线小说听书网站源码修复版+手机版,内附安装教程
  9. django---加载INSTALLED_APPS的源码分析
  10. 2040年,上海会成为5400万人口的“超级魔都”吗?